logo

Output e66b13fe452287213ad4d468b8c459a422a0708d911e4b00deca7ae191fd504e:0

value
23597314
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 94dba99bd01e4be3302dad66bfdd3c47eee62600 OP_EQUALVERIFY OP_CHECKSIG
address
1Ea69p4GaMXf3mWW79bdR7Aot7f8SSXKyZ
transaction
e66b13fe452287213ad4d468b8c459a422a0708d911e4b00deca7ae191fd504e